Some factories run hot.
Their equipment is set for high temperatures. Or they need extra heat resistance for summer storage. That is why we make our thermoplastic hot melt adhesive. The working temperature is 160-180°C. The glue has high inner strength and high heat resistance. It is used for barrier cuff elastic fixing and waistband bonding. Areas that need a very strong bond. We call it the heat-resistant fortress. In our tests, it keeps the product intact during hot summer storage. No glue flow. No sticking. No edge lifting. No bond failure.

The blend gives high inner strength.
We use SIS and SBS together. SIS gives elasticity. SBS gives strength and heat resistance. We build a strong 3D network. The melt viscosity at 160°C is 3000-6000 mPa·s. That is high. The glue layer must be thick enough for high stress. The softening point is 90-105°C. Much higher than normal. That gives excellent heat resistance.
Here is the heat resistance data.
In our 60°C/72 hour test, the glue does not soften, flow, or lift at the edges. The softening point of 90-105°C is far above the normal 80-95°C.

Peel strength is 12-20 N/25mm. That is 1.5-2 times normal. Holding power lasts over 72 hours at 40°C. Even under 2.5-3.5 times elastic stretch, it stays stable. We add a good antioxidant system. In our 180°C/24 hour tank test, color change (ΔE) is less than 3. No skin. No carbon. That is our thermoplastic hot melt adhesive.
